How We Work
1
Immediate Response
Your call triggers our 24/7 dispatch. We deploy a rapid-response team with powerful water extraction equipment. This minimizes damage and sets the stage for a thorough assessment.
2
Damage Assessment
Our IICRC-certified technicians use thermal imaging cameras to detect hidden moisture. We meticulously document the affected areas. This comprehensive evaluation informs our detailed drying plan.
3
Water Extraction
Using industrial-grade pumps and vacuums, we remove standing water quickly. We extract water from carpets, subflooring, and structural cavities. This critical step prevents mold growth.
4
Drying & Dehumidification
High-powered air movers and commercial dehumidifiers create optimal drying conditions. We monitor moisture levels daily. This ensures your property is completely dry, preparing it for sanitation.
5
Cleaning & Sanitizing
We clean and sanitize all affected surfaces to prevent bacterial growth and odors. Our team uses EPA-approved disinfectants. This restores a healthy indoor environment before any repairs.
6
Restoration & Repair
Our skilled craftsmen repair or replace damaged drywall, flooring, and other structural elements. We restore your property to its pre-damage condition. Your satisfaction is our final goal.

Septic Tank Backup Water Removal Cost In Mechanicsville, VA

The cost of septic tank backup water removal in Mechanicsville, VA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team offers free estimates to help you understand the costs involved. Here are some typical price ranges for our services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Response and Assessment $500 - $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ions.
Water Removal and Drying $2,000 - $10,000 Amount of water, complexity of the job, and equipment required.
Debris Removal and Disinfection $1,500 - $6,000 Amount of debris, type of materials involved, and level of contamination.
Structural Drying and Repair $3,000 - $15,000 Complexity of the job, type of materials involved, and level of damage.

Keep in mind that these are just estimates, and the actual cost of septic tank backup water removal will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to help you understand the costs involved.
